Barton track and field add seven new qualifiers, women win NAIA/JUCO Challenge with Williams and Walters making program record book implications #GoBarton
The women's squad of the Barton Community College track and field program led the highlights Saturday competing at the NAIA/JUCO Challenge held at Pittsburg State University's Robert W. Plaster Center.
Winning three of the events, the women scored 97 points for a 6.5 point victory against athletes from various NAIA and junior college competitors while the men placed 5th on two winning events in an equally highly competitive field of thirty different schools.
Overall the program added seven new national qualifiers within their 35 personal or season bests efforts, two of those making impacts on the storied Barton women's Top-10 record book.
For the second consecutive meet Cedricka Williams achieved a personal best weight throw, this time marking a near two-foot improvement of 17.41m (57-1.50) to move two slots up into the 7th position of Barton's all-time best performances.
Fellow sophomore Shone Walters is also off to a great start to the indoor season, slicing nearly four seconds off last week's time in clocking a 2:12.85 to slide into the 10th position all-time.
Both were previously nationally qualified in the events and finished second overall on Saturday.
Also previously qualified but winning their events on Saturday were a pair of freshmen, Asharria Ulett winning her second consecutive 60m hurdle event clocking the nation's second fastest time of 8.54 in missing the program's top ten by .02 seconds, and Celine Riddle marking also a nation's second best mark with a long jump distance of 5.74m (18-10).
The women's other victory came in the 4x400m relay, the tandem of Walters, Natasha Fox, Keliza Smith, and Narissa McPherson passing the baton in a nation's leading 3:46.84 clock stoppage.
On the men's side both event winners came in the field events, Ricardo Hayles improving his shot put qualifying mark to a nation's fourth best 16.99m (55-9.00) to distance the field by over two feet.
Reigning NJCAA Men's Athlete of the Week Trevon Hamer traded the triple for the long jump this weekend adding his second qualifying event, chalking up another event win by marking a nation's current third best distance on a personal record 7.53m (24-8.50).
Following their two in-state meets to open the season, the Cougars will next head to Lubbock, Texas for the two-day Stan Scott Invite & Multis hosted by Texas Tech University.
